Welcome to on-call for the Glimmerpane design system! Our snapshot tests live in the `snapcheck` suite and run on every merge to main. If a UI component changes visually, the diff bot flags it — usually it's an intentional tweak, so just approve the new baseline. If it's 2am and snapshots are failing across the board, it's almost always a font-loading race, not your problem. To unlock the baseline store and re-approve snapshots in bulk, use the recovery passphrase below.

recovery phrase for tahag-taguf: wenix-caswyn

# Break-Glass: Catalog Cache Invalidation

Scope: the Pinrow product catalog at Veldstone Retail. If stale prices persist after a purge and the Hollowmere invalidation queue is wedged, use break-glass to flush the edge tier directly. Contractors: get verbal sign-off from the catalog lead first. Steps: open the Hollowmere admin shell, select emergency-flush, confirm the tenant, and run it once — repeated flushes thrash the origin. Access is logged and expires after 20 minutes. Unseal the admin shell with the passphrase below.

recovery phrase for kahop-tajog: istix-casvan

# NOTE FOR FUTURE MAINTAINERS (payroll export change)
# As of the Lanternwick v9 release, payroll exports moved from the
# fixed-width GLX format to delimited PYX files. The old format is
# still generated for one archive consumer; do not remove it until
# finance confirms cutover. Column order is now driven by the
# export_schema table rather than hardcoded mappings, so any new
# field must be registered there first. The exporter reads that
# table from the payroll database using the connection string below.

warehouse DSN: clickhouse://druys_svc:Pl@db-47e1.orvexstack.corp:5432/beldor

Welcome to the Mossgrain data platform! Quick note for your review: all event tables are partitioned by month, and retention jobs drop whole partitions rather than deleting rows. That matters for you because access grants are partition-scoped — a stale grant on a dropped partition just vanishes, no audit trail. We know, not ideal. The partition lifecycle, grant mapping, and the audit gaps we've flagged so far are all written up on the internal page below.

dashboard of tahop-fahof = https://harbor.tolvaqnet.example/secrets/merge_requests/board/issue/merge_requests/pipeline/secrets/ecb30ed86a55c001a77f6cb9